When Ron and Evan Wedrick were seriously injured in the wild fires near Tompkins in October, friend and neighbor Ruth Magee was quick to take the lead and organize a benefit fundriaser for the family that to date has raised about $184,000 with more donations coming in. She adds they've received donations from Lumsden to Calgary and all points in between.

Ruth was jointly nominated by the communties of Carmichael, Tompkins, and Gull Lake and is quick to say it wasn't just her, but an entire community effort from many volunteers and people willing to donate and help in any way. Ruth said she accepts the recognition on behalf of everyone. 

Ron and Even continue their recovery in a Calgary hospital and are healing and making progress but it will continue to be a a long, uphill battle.
